Summary
Westech Capital Corp. has agreed to borrow $500,050 from First United Bank under this promissory note dated October 21, 2002. The loan carries a variable interest rate initially set at 6.25% and is to be repaid in 17 monthly installments of $30,000 and a final payment due by May 1, 2004. The lender can demand full repayment at any time. The agreement outlines payment terms, interest calculations, prepayment options, and events that would constitute default, such as missed payments or insolvency.

PROMISE TO PAY, WESTECH CAPITAL CORP. ("BORROWER") PROMISES TO PAY TO FIRST UNITED BANK ("LENDER"), OR ORDER, IN LAWFUL MONEY OF THE UNITED STATES OF AMERICA, THE PRINCIPAL AMOUNT OF FIVE HUNDRED THOUSAND FIFTY & 00/100 Dollars ($500,05O.00), TOGETHER WITH INTEREST ON THE UNPAID PRINCIPAL BALANCE FROM OCTOBER 21, 2002, UNTIL MATURITY. PAYMENT, SUBJECT TO ANY PAYMENT CHANGES RESULTING FROM CHANGES IN THE INDEX, BORROWER WILL PAY THIS LOAN ON DEMAND. PAYMENT IN FULL IS DUE IMMEDIATELY UPON LENDER'S DEMAND. IF NO DEMAND IS MADE, BORROWER WILL PAY THIS LOAN IN 17 REGULAR PAYMENTS OF $30,000.00 EACH AND ONE IRREGULAR LAST PAYMENT ESTIMATED AT $15,841.42. BORROWER'S FIRST PAYMENT IS DUE DECEMBER 1, 2002, AND ALL SUBSEQUENT PAYMENTS ARE DUE ON THE SAME DAY OF EACH MONTH AFTER THAT. BORROWER'S FINAL PAYMENT WILL BE DUE ON MAY 1, 2004, AND WILL BE FOR ALL PRINCIPAL AND ALL ACCRUED INTEREST NOT YET PAID. PAYMENTS INCLUDE PRINCIPAL AND INTEREST. UNLESS OTHERWISE AGREED OR REQUIRED BY APPLICABLE LAW, PAYMENTS WILL BE APPLIED FIRST TO ACCRUED UNPAID INTEREST, THEN TO PRINCIPAL, AND ANY REMAINING AMOUNT TO ANY UNPAID COLLECTION COSTS. THE ANNUAL INTEREST RATE FOR THIS NOTE IS COMPUTED ON A 365/360 BASIS; THAT IS, BY APPLYING THE RATIO OF THE ANNUAL INTEREST RATE OVER A YEAR OR 360 DAYS, MULTIPLIED BY THE OUTSTANDING PRINCIPAL BALANCE, MULTIPLIED BY THE ACTUAL NUMBER OF DAYS THE PRINCIPAL BALANCE IS OUTSTANDING, UNLESS SUCH CALCULATION WOULD RESULT IN A USURIOUS RATE, IN WHICH CASE INTEREST SHALL BE CALCULATED ON A PER DIEM BASIS OF A YEAR OF 365 OR 366 DAYS, AS THE CASE MAY BE. BORROWER WILL PAY LENDER AT LENDER'S ADDRESS SHOWN ABOVE OR AT SUCH OTHER PLACE AS LENDER MAY DESIGNATE IN WRITING. VARIABLE INTEREST RATE. The Interest rate on this Note is subject to change from time to time based on changes in an independent index which is the Wall Street Journal Prime Rate (the "Index"). The Index is not necessarily the lowest rate charged by Lender on its loans. If the Index becomes unavailable during the term of this loan, Lender may designate a substitute Index after notice to Borrower. Lender will tell Borrower the current Index rate upon Borrowers request. The Interest rate change will not occur more often than each Day. Borrower understands that Lender may make loans based on other rates as well. THE INDEX CURRENTLY IS 4.750% PER ANNUM. THE INTEREST RATE TO BE APPLIED PRIOR TO MATURITY TO THE UNPAID PRINCIPAL BALANCE OF THIS NOTE WILL BE AT A RATE OF 1.500 PERCENTAGE POINTS OVER THE INDEX, RESULTING IN AN INITIAL RATE OF 6.250% PER ANNUM.
